There should be 3 or 4 dates of this type (each) for the MCDS, BCDS, and OCDS. Theses datasets are used in rotation and kept track of by DFHSM. All 4 of DFHSM.MCDS.BACKUP.Vxxxxxx need to be enlarged. There is no need to copy the data. These are point in time backups from the beginning of the space management cycle.
